HIGH SCHOOL: A 2017 graduate of Palo Verde High School in Las Vegas, Nev. … Originally from Brisbane, Australia … Was back-to-back individual Nevada State High School Champion (2015 & 2016), while he was runner-up in 2017 … Was ranked as the No. 21 player in the country when he signed with the Rebels (Golfweek Junior Boys Rankings) … Won the 2016 AJGA Ryan Moore Championship, the 2015 San Diego Junior Amateur Championship and the 2015 Clark County Amateur Championship … He had the low round of 62 in the 2016 Shriner’s Open Pre-Qualifier, he was the runner-up at the 2016 Las Vegas City Amateur and he finished 12th at the 2016 PING Invitational … He was medalist at the 2016 Tournament of Champions at Rio Secco … His high school team was coached by Todd Steffenhagen … He lettered three years on varsity and the team won two state titles … During the summer of 2017, he finished third at the U.S. Amateur Qualifier.
PERSONAL: Jack Trent was born Nov. 19, 1998, in Brisbane, Queensland, Australia … The son of John and Louise Trent … Majoring in business … Has two brothers, Harrison (17) and Taylor (16).
